Grand Hyatt Bali Participates in the First Sustainable Food Festival

From 27 September to 16 October 2021, Grand Hyatt Bali will participate in the first–ever Sustainable Food Festival, initiated by Bali Hotel Association (BHA) to raise the awareness on  sustainable living, especially in tourism. Joined by 30 leading hotels in Bali, the festival allows each participant to showcase the innovative programmes it has been creating […]

The Apurva Kempinski Bali Celebrates Sustainability

The Apurva Kempinski Bali has been known to implement a series of initiatives, each targeting different aspects of its sustainability commitment. As part of these initiatives, the resort has recently announced the launch of its Rooftop Garden. Using the rooftop space to grow various types of greens, this Rooftop Garden is set to establish a more […]

Literacy Support for Bali’s Children

After 19 years of working to improve educational opportunities for children in Bali’s remote communities, Bali Children Foundation (BCF) faces the risk that COVID will undo a generation of life-changing work. In July, children will return to school. All of them deeply impacted by the lack of access to their classrooms for the last 16 […]

Educating the dangers of Single-Use Plastic with Mudfish No Plastic

Plastic waste is a huge problem in Indonesia that we all need to work hand-in-hand to minimize the dangers that have been devastating to our environment and oceans. MUDFISH NO PLASTIC is a community-based initiative that turns into a non-profit organization registered in Bali. They travel to remote villages throughout the islands of Indonesia to […]
